Kermit None Of My Business Meme
Nov. 27, 2024
Kermit None Of My Business Meme Sticker - Kermit Tea Meme Sticker - Kermit Meme - Kermit Tea Meme - Kermit Decal : Handmade Products - Amazon.com Kermit but thats none of my business meme" Poster for Sale by NikkiMouse82 | Redbubble Kermit meems Kermit None Of My Business Meme